您所在的位置:首页 - 科普 - 正文科普

深入解析CSS,从入门到精通的全指南

照铨
照铨 2024-09-22 【科普】 129人已围观

摘要在这个数字化的时代,网页设计和用户体验已经成为任何在线业务成功的关键因素之一,作为自媒体作者,我明白学习CSS(层叠样式表)的重要性,它不仅关乎网站的美观,更是提升交互性和可访问性的重要工具,在这篇文章中,我们将一起踏上CSS的学习之旅,从基础概念到高级技巧,让你全面掌握这一强大的前端语言,第一部分:CSS基础……

在这个数字化的时代,网页设计和用户体验已经成为任何在线业务成功的关键因素之一,作为自媒体作者,我明白学习CSS(层叠样式表)的重要性,它不仅关乎网站的美观,更是提升交互性和可访问性的重要工具,在这篇文章中,我们将一起踏上CSS的学习之旅,从基础概念到高级技巧,让你全面掌握这一强大的前端语言。

第一部分:CSS基础入门

1、何为CSS?

CSS是一种样式表语言,用于描述HTML或XML(包括如SVG等其他标记语言)文档的呈现,通过CSS,你可以控制文本样式、布局、颜色、图像和动画等元素。

2、CSS语法概览

学习CSS的第一步是理解其基本语法,包括选择器、属性和值,以及使用分号分隔的声明方式。

第二部分:CSS选择器与布局

3、选择器种类

子元素选择器、类选择器、ID选择器、通用选择器和伪类等,每种都有其特定用途,灵活运用可以实现精准的样式控制。

4、盒模型与布局

深入解析CSS,从入门到精通的全指南

理解盒模型(content、padding、border、margin)对于布局至关重要,浮动、定位和Flexbox/Grid布局能帮助你创建响应式设计。

第三部分:CSS颜色与文本样式

5、颜色理论与应用

学习颜色命名、十六进制、RGB、RGBA等颜色模式,以及如何使用CSS预处理器(如Sass、Less)定义变量和混合颜色。

6、字体与文本样式

掌握字体家族、字体大小、对齐方式、行高、文本修饰等,让文字更具吸引力。

第四部分:CSS布局与交互

7、响应式设计

了解媒体查询如何帮助你的网站适应不同设备尺寸,实现自适应布局。

8、动画与过渡

使用关键帧动画(@keyframes)和transition属性,给用户带来动态的视觉体验。

9、交互与伪元素

通过hover、active、focus等伪类,实现鼠标悬停、点击等行为的样式变化。

第五部分:CSS实战项目

10、搭建基础网站

结合前面学到的知识,实际操作构建一个简单的静态网站,加深理解和记忆。

11、CSS最佳实践与性能优化

提高代码效率,遵循CSS编写规范,以及如何使用CSS预处理器和模块化工具来组织代码。

学习CSS是一个持续的过程,随着技术的发展,新的特性和技术不断出现,希望这篇指南能为你提供一个坚实的基础,让你在前端开发的道路上越走越远,无论你是初学者还是经验丰富的开发者,始终保持好奇心,勇于探索CSS的无限可能,你将创造出令人惊艳的数字世界。

最近发表

icp沪ICP备2023034348号-8
取消
微信二维码
支付宝二维码

目录[+]